Ya, I have a new unibody macbook and it doesn't let you do dfu mode. I believe there is a fix for it in a thread in this forum somewhere but have never tried it. I just use my pc with vista on it everytime I have to use quickpwn (which you would have to go to the windows quickpwn tutorial to download the windows version of quickpwn).
